Output 75d112fa4f708d4e58694223115ee633e51dd22a7a15137c7624bd22635f06b3:2

value
142472144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f47858ffdf467fa877acbcd3414a57313622980c OP_EQUAL
address
3PyeyFZx7DR7GkFxsWoCqhuBv1d7Exttk8
transaction
75d112fa4f708d4e58694223115ee633e51dd22a7a15137c7624bd22635f06b3
spent
true